Michael Wiles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Sep. 22, 2025.
Michael Reed Wiles, 70, of Lolita, Texas, passed away peacefully on September 6, 2025.

Michael was born on October 27, 1954, in Niles, Michigan, to Mahlon Wiles and Rose Marie Thompson Wiles. He graduated high school in 1973 and proudly served his country in the United States Air Force from 1975 to 1982. Enlisting in Harrisburg, Virginia, Michael's service took him to the Philippines, where he dedicated himself to duty with honor.

After his military service, Michael relocated to Port Lavaca, Texas, to be closer to his parents following their retirement. He worked for Shoalwater Boats and in various carpentry roles before spending 15 years in maintenance at the Royale Inn. In 2011, Michael experienced a stroke that left him wheelchair bound, yet he faced life's challenges with courage and perseverance.

Michael was preceded in death by his parents; his sister, Theresa Wiles Thompson; and his mother-in-law, Adele Sutton. He is survived by his loving partner of 22 years, Mary Bush; his stepson, Samuel Keith Bush, and wife Kimberly; his cherished grandchildren, Tyler Chesser (Tristen), Kade and Kinley Bush; and great granddaughter Whitley Chesser. He is also survived by his brother-in-law, Rick Thompson, and niece, Carisa Thompson; his brother-in-law and sister-in-law, Andy and Gail Wolfskill; as well as extended family and many friends who will miss his steady presence and kind spirit.

The family extends heartfelt gratitude to everyone who made Michael's life comfortable in his final weeks, with a special thank you to Morgan from Heart to Heart for giving him his last haircut.

A memorial service will be held on October 4, 2025, at 11:00 a.m., followed immediately by a reception at Brookside Funeral Home-Cypress Creek, 9149 Highway 6 N, Houston, TX 77095.

Michael will be remembered for his service, his dedication to family, and the quiet strength with which he lived his life.
